Scherer 17*/ 18 19#include "unicode/uobject.h" 20#include "cmemory.h" 21 22U_NAMESPACE_BEGIN 23 24#if U_OVERRIDE_CXX_ALLOCATION 25 26/* 27 * Default implementation of UMemory::new/delete 28 * using uprv_malloc() and uprv_free(). 29 * 30 * For testing, this is used together with a list of imported symbols to verify 31 * that ICU is not using the global ::new and ::delete operators. 32 * 33 * These operators can be implemented like this or any other appropriate way 34 * when customizing ICU for certain environments. 35 * Whenever ICU is customized in binary incompatible ways please be sure 36 * to use library name suffixes to distinguish such libraries from 37 * the standard build. 38 * 39 * Instead of just modifying these C++ new/delete operators, it is usually best 40 * to modify the uprv_malloc()/uprv_free()/uprv_realloc() functions in cmemory.c. 41 * 42 * Memory test on Windows/MSVC 6: 43 * The global operators new and delete look as follows: 44 * 04F 00000000 UNDEF notype () External | ??2@YAPAXI@Z (void * __cdecl operator new(unsigned int)) 45 * 03F 00000000 UNDEF notype () External | ??3@YAXPAX@Z (void __cdecl operator delete(void *)) 46 * 47 * These lines are from output generated by the MSVC 6 tool dumpbin with 48 * dumpbin /symbols *.obj 49 * 50 * ??2@YAPAXI@Z and ??3@YAXPAX@Z are the linker symbols in the .obj 51 * files and are imported from msvcrtd.dll (in a debug build). 52 * 53 * Make sure that with the UMemory operators new and delete defined these two symbols 54 * do not appear in the dumpbin /symbols output for the ICU libraries! 55 * 56 * If such a symbol appears in the output then look in the preceding lines in the output 57 * for which file and function calls the global new or delete operator, 58 * and replace with uprv_malloc/uprv_free. 59 */ 60 61void * U_EXPORT2 UMemory::operator new(size_t size) noexcept { 62 return uprv_malloc(size); 63} 64 65void U_EXPORT2 UMemory::operator delete(void *p) noexcept { 66 if(p!=nullptr) { 67 uprv_free(p); 68 } 69} 70 71void * U_EXPORT2 UMemory::operator new[](size_t size) noexcept { 72 return uprv_malloc(size); 73} 74 75void U_EXPORT2 UMemory::operator delete[](void *p) noexcept { 76 if(p!=nullptr) { 77 uprv_free(p); 78 } 79} 80 81#if U_HAVE_DEBUG_LOCATION_NEW 82void * U_EXPORT2 UMemory::operator new(size_t size, const char* /*file*/, int /*line*/) noexcept { 83 return UMemory::operator new(size); 84} 85 86void U_EXPORT2 UMemory::operator delete(void* p, const char* /*file*/, int /*line*/) noexcept { 87 UMemory::operator delete(p); 88} 89#endif /* U_HAVE_DEBUG_LOCATION_NEW */ 90 91 92#endif 93 94UObject::~UObject() {} 95 96UClassID UObject::getDynamicClassID() const { return nullptr; } 97 98U_NAMESPACE_END 99 100U_NAMESPACE_USE 101 102U_CAPI void U_EXPORT2 103uprv_deleteUObject(void *obj) { 104 delete static_cast<UObject *>(obj); 105} 106
